I'm gettin a 3" rough country lift for my 1999 cherokee sport. Whats the biggest tires i could fit under the 3" lift without cutting fenders? I'm lookin at 31's right now.

'99 with 4.5 and 31's. did some VERY minor trimming in front of the front fender flare extension on the bumper. can't see it. but i didn't really have to. 

Gonna depend on the vehicle and the lift kit. Some have to trim, others don't.
Running 31's on mine with a 3" kit. Trimmed an inch from the front bumper end caps and bumpstopped all the way around. Works well for me.

This a 3" with 31's. No fender trimming or bump stopping. It'll stuff the fronts but ended up cleaning out the plastic inner fenders. With some bump stopping everything would fit o.k. We flexed it pretty hard and no damage other than the inner fender thing.
It's an RC kit and we're pretty happy with it.

The back tires will stuff fine without making any contact. If you bump stopped and trimmed fenders you might be able to do 32's or even 33's..........maybe.
